I too am so tired of this "where there's smoke there must be fire" logic. Even if we take the worse case scenario that Wells laid out, the halftime measurements and using the gauge that Anderson said he did not use. The one that always measured a lower PSI.

The average PSI of the Pats balls were 98.14% of what Exponent said they should be. All balls were between 92.765 and 104.68% of what they should be.

When you throw in

1)the built-in inaccuracy of the crappy gauges (the same gauge measured 3 different readings on the intercepted ball)
2) the unclear timing of the measurements (the first balls would be lower as they had not warmed up yet) but nobody is sure when there measurements took place.

There is no goddamn way you could come to a conclusion of tampering. NONE!! ZILCH!! ZERO!!!

Why is this so hard for the rest of the world outside of NE to understand?

Edit --> It just hit me that most folks still "think" that the Pats balls were 10.1 when they should be at least 12.5. That initial leak did all the damage. The rest is just filling out the death certificate.
